Billie was married to Levi Adcock of Quinton, Oklahoma. They were blessed with two sons, Norvel Dean Adcock, born August 22, 1957 and Arnold Gene Adcock, born November 16, 1959. Billie and Levi were later divorced. Billie worked in the home while the children were small then went to work at Western Electric until her retirement.
Billie found a DEAR FRIEND in Jim Buchanan of Spencer, OK. They enjoyed many, many years of companionship. They enjoyed traveling together, playing dominoes with family and friends and going out to eat at their special restaurants. In later years, due to health problems, Billie moved near her niece Linda at Broken Arrow, OK to an assisted living facility. Jim called her everyday to check how she was doing. He truly was her special friend.
Billie was preceded in death by her son, Norvel Dean Adcock, of Catoosa, OK; her daughter-in-law, Brenda Adcock of Quinton, OK; her father, RB Clark of Brownsville, Texas; her mother, Eva Clark of Oklahoma City, OK; her sister, Virginia Clark of Copan, OK; her brother, RB Jr. (Sonny) of Del City, OK; her grandparents, Mr. and Mrs. William Clark of Jones, OK; Estel and Grace Sanders of Oklahoma City, OK and many a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.
Billie is survived by her son, Arnold Gene Adcock of Quinton, OK; her nieces, Linda Owen and her husband Earnie of Broken Arrow, OK and Helen Jeter and her husband Joe of Copan, OK; six grandchildren, Chris, Rodney, Valorie, Matthew, Brooke, and Autumn; fifteen great-grandchildren, and one great-great-grandson; four great-nephews and their wives; five great-great-nieces; five great-great-nephews; and Jim Buchanan of Spencer, OK.
